Gas, particularly propane and natural gas, is highly flammable. Understanding how to handle and use gas safely is paramount to avoid potentially dangerous situations. Here are some essential safety measures to keep in mind:

1. Regular Maintenance
One of the most critical aspects of gas safety is regular maintenance of your gas appliances. Over time, gas lines and appliances may develop leaks or wear down. Schedule annual maintenance checks with a certified technician to inspect your gas lines, valves, and appliances for any issues. Addressing problems early can prevent dangerous situations down the road.

2. Proper Ventilation
Good ventilation is essential when using gas appliances. Ensure that your home has adequate ventilation in areas where gas is used. A well-ventilated space allows gas to disperse quickly, reducing the risk of gas buildup and potential explosions. Install and maintain carbon monoxide detectors in your home to alert you to any dangerous gas leaks.

3. Secure Gas Cylinder Storage
If you use gas cylinders, store them in a well-ventilated, upright position. Keep them outdoors or in a dedicated gas cylinder storage area, away from direct sunlight and heat sources. Ensure that cylinders are not exposed to extreme temperatures, which can increase pressure and the risk of leaks.

4. Professional Installation
Never attempt to install gas appliances or make gas line connections yourself. Always hire a licensed and experienced professional to handle installation and any modifications to your gas supply. This ensures that the installation meets safety standards and local regulations.

5. Educate Household Members
Ensure that all members of your household, including children, are aware of the potential dangers of gas and understand basic safety procedures. Teach them how to recognize the smell of gas (a rotten egg odor) and what to do if they suspect a gas leak (leave the area immediately and call emergency services).

6. Emergency Response
Have a plan in place for dealing with gas-related emergencies. Know how to shut off the gas supply to your home if necessary and have a readily accessible emergency contact list for gas company services and emergency responders.
